    <description>&lt;P&gt;I'm trying to present disks from an AFF-200 to a Windows 2008 R2 server, via SnapDrive 7.1.5.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;When I attempt to&amp;nbsp;Establish the iSCSI session, I immediately receive an error informing me that&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;"You cannot establish more iSCSI sessions with the selected Storage System because you do not have MPIO installed on this system, or all possible iSCSI sessions are already established.&amp;nbsp; Click finish to exit...."&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I can confirm that: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;1) I do have Data OnTap DSM 4.1.4348.1209 installed and the MPIO for the FC disks are displaying as expected&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;2) I have have not reached maximum iSCSI sessions (According to the HWU, I should be ok for 8192)&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;3) I have the same software stack installed on 2 other identical servers.&amp;nbsp; The only difference I can see is that under the Windows MPIO, I do not see this entry on the problematic server: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;MPIO NETAPP LUN FlashRay&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I have tried reinstalled all of the software but no luck.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Does anyone have anything?&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Have you installed the required HotFixes for 2008R2?&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Unless you know someone who has them they are impossible to find as Microsoft disabled the site for them last year.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Have you tried to attach iSCSI via the MS iSCSI GUI? Being sure to select multiplath while configuring?&lt;/P&gt;</description>
